The release of The Mummy in Hindi was a landmark moment. It proved that there was a massive, untapped audience for Hollywood content beyond India's metropolitan English-speaking elite. The massive box office numbers for Hollywood films, which jumped from 8 million attendees in 1992 to 50 million in 2000, were largely driven by these dubbed versions. The success of The Mummy encouraged other studios to invest heavily in dubbing, opening the doors for countless other Hollywood films to find success in the Indian market.

The late 90s was a transitional phase for Indian television and cinema. Cable TV was booming, and channels like Sony Max, Star Gold, and Zee Cinema were hungry for content that could rival Bollywood.
